What is the lung disease that makes the lining of the bronchial tubes swollen and painful?
bronchitis
Disease in which the air sacs (alveoli) fill with liquid.
Pneumonia
Disorder that makes the bronchial tubes narrow and swollen.
asthma
What is injury or death from electricity called?
electrocution
What is the body system that moves substances throughout the body?
circulatory system
What causes a stroke?
When cholesterol builds up inside the blood vessel walls and causes a lack of blood to the brain.
What causes high blood pressure?
When cholesterol builds up in the blood vessel walls and the force against the blood vessel walls is too great.
What causes cholesterol build up in the blood vessels?
Eating too many foods with high saturated fat, cholesterol, or sodium.

Lung disease in which the cells in the lungs grow out of control.
lung cancer
What is in heart-healthy food?
Fiber, other nutrients, little to no cholesterol, sodium, or saturated fats
One of the two tubes that leads from the trachea to the lungs.
bronchial tube
What is the tube that leads from the throat toward the lungs?
trachea
What is the force of blood against the walls of the blood vessels?
blood pressure
tiny blood vessel that carries blood to cells
capillary
What is the process of taking in oxygen and removing carbon dioxide?
Respiration
What is the body system that takes oxygen from the air and removes carbon dioxide from the body?
respiratory system
Blood vessel that carries blood away from the heart.
artery
blood vessel that carries blood back toward the heart
vein
tube that carries blood throughout the body.
blood vessel
